MCFT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2017 in Review

106 of the 4,022 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in MasterCraft Boat Holdings (MCFT) for Q2 2017, worth a combined $342M — up 27% from $269M a quarter earlier.

Fund positioning in MCFT was balanced in Q2 2017: 13 funds opened new positions, 13 closed out, 43 added to existing stakes and 40 trimmed.

The largest buyer was BlackRock, adding an estimated $10.2M. The largest seller was Wellington Management Group, cutting an estimated $12.8M.
